Transaction 62d374e4bf8939365914522cedd0de16fac36135fdc4d1f2e885fd286b3967ca
1 Input
2 Outputs
- 62d374e4bf8939365914522cedd0de16fac36135fdc4d1f2e885fd286b3967ca:0
- 62d374e4bf8939365914522cedd0de16fac36135fdc4d1f2e885fd286b3967ca:1
value 494295821
address 18WBjCbsuuWyUW5zG6qGhFtmGy6HCE5pVG
value 1266000
address 3CGxHQbfEJJkxSSM9KT8Z6eawbkWqdK9xj